5 votes

Answer: 252 ft²

Explanation:

Based on the picture, the scale drawing of the kitchen is 1.75 in by 2.25 in.

We will convert these measurements using the scale,
(1)/(4) in = 2 ft. We will use dimensional analysis.

1.75 in ➜
(1.75\;in)((2\;ft)/(0.25\;in))=14\;ft

2.25 in ➜
(2.25\;in)((2\;ft)/(0.25\;in))=18\;ft

Lastly, we will solve for the area using the formula below.

A = LW

A = (14 ft)(18 ft)

A = 252 ft²
